Вопросы с тегом «java»

134
Добавить зависимость в Maven

Как мне взять jar-файл, который у меня есть, и добавить его в систему зависимостей в maven 2? Я буду поддерживать эту зависимость, и моему коду нужен этот jar в пути к классам, чтобы он...

134
Как использовать классы из файлов .jar?

Я прочитал учебники по Java для Sun для файлов JAR, но все еще не могу найти решение своей проблемы. Мне нужно использовать класс из jar-файла с именем jtwitter.jar, я скачал этот файл и попытался его выполнить (вчера я узнал, что файлы .jar можно выполнить, дважды щелкнув по ним), и Vista выдавала...

134
Hibernate Аннотации - что лучше, доступ к полю или собственности?

Этот вопрос в некоторой степени связан с вопросом размещения аннотации в спящем режиме . Но я хочу знать, что лучше ? Доступ через свойства или доступ через поля? Каковы преимущества и недостатки...

134
Нумерация сборок и версий для проектов Java (ant, cvs, hudson)

Каковы современные рекомендации по систематической нумерации сборок и управлению номерами версий в проектах Java? В частности: Как систематически управлять номерами сборки в распределенной среде разработки Как сохранить номера версий в исходном / доступном для приложения времени выполнения Как...

134
Согласованность hashCode () в строке Java

Значение hashCode Java String вычисляется как ( String.hashCode () ): s[0]*31^(n-1) + s[1]*31^(n-2) + ... + s[n-1] Существуют ли какие-либо обстоятельства (например, версия JVM, поставщик и т. Д.), При которых следующее выражение будет оцениваться как ложное? boolean expression = "This is a Java...

134
Лучшая библиотека виджетов GWT? [закрыто]

В настоящее время этот вопрос не очень подходит для нашего формата вопросов и ответов. Мы ожидаем, что ответы будут подтверждены фактами, ссылками или опытом, но этот вопрос, скорее всего, вызовет дебаты, споры, опрос или расширенное обсуждение. Если вы считаете, что этот вопрос можно улучшить и,...

134
Почему Eclipse жалуется на @Override в интерфейсных методах?

У меня есть существующий проект, который использует @Overrideметоды, которые переопределяют методы интерфейса , а не методы суперкласса. Я не могу изменить это в коде, но я бы хотел, чтобы Eclpse прекратил жаловаться на аннотацию, поскольку я все еще могу строить с Maven. Как бы я отключил эту...

134
Отключить ведение журнала HttpClient

Я использую commons-httpclient 3.1 в наборе интеграционных тестов. Ведение журнала по умолчанию для HttpClient очень шумно, и я не могу его отключить. Я пробовал следовать приведенным здесь инструкциям, но ни одна из них не имеет никакого значения. В большинстве случаев мне просто нужно, чтобы...

134
Самый эффективный способ привести List <SubClass> к List <BaseClass>

У меня есть файл, List<SubClass>который я хочу рассматривать как List<BaseClass>. Похоже, это не должно быть проблемой, поскольку приведение a SubClassк a BaseClass- несложная задача , но мой компилятор жалуется, что приведение невозможно. Итак, как лучше всего получить ссылку на те же...

134
Получено фатальное предупреждение: handshake_failure через SSLHandshakeException

У меня проблема с авторизованным соединением SSL. Я создал действие Struts, которое подключается к внешнему серверу с помощью сертификата Client Authorized SSL. В своем действии я пытаюсь отправить некоторые данные на сервер банка, но безуспешно, потому что в результате с сервера произошла...

134
Чем фреймворк fork / join лучше, чем пул потоков?

Каковы преимущества использования новой структуры fork / join по сравнению с простым разделением большой задачи на N подзадач вначале, отправкой их в кэшированный пул потоков (от Executors ) и ожиданием завершения каждой задачи? Я не вижу, как использование абстракции fork / join упрощает проблему...

134
Как получить максимальное значение из коллекции (например, ArrayList)?

Существует ArrayList, который хранит целочисленные значения. Мне нужно найти максимальное значение в этом списке. Например, предположим, что сохраненные значения arrayList: 10, 20, 30, 40, 50и максимальное значение будет 50. Какой эффективный способ найти максимальное значение? @ Редактировать: я...

134
Можете ли вы объяснить процесс подключения HttpURLConnection?

Я использую HTTPURLConnectionдля подключения к веб-сервису. Я знаю, как использовать, HTTPURLConnectionно я хочу понять, как это работает. В основном, я хочу знать следующее: В какой момент HTTPURLConnectionпытается установить соединение с данным URL? В какой момент я могу узнать, что мне удалось...

134
Привести объект к универсальному типу для возврата

Есть ли способ привести объект к возврату значения метода? Я пробовал этот способ, но он дал исключение времени компиляции в части "instanceof": public static <T> T convertInstanceOfObject(Object o) { if (o instanceof T) { return (T) o; } else { return null; } } Я тоже пробовал это, но он дал...

134
JMS и AMQP - RabbitMQ

Я пытаюсь понять, что такое JMS и как это связано с терминологией AMQP. Я знаю, что JMS - это API, а AMQP - это протокол. Вот мои предположения (и вопросы тоже) RabbitMQ использует протокол AMQP (скорее реализует протокол AMQP) Клиенты Java должны использовать клиентские библиотеки протокола AMQP...

134
Mvn install или Mvn package

Я новичок в Maven, у меня есть веб-проект на основе Java с maven, настроенным в моем MyEclipse. Теперь, если я изменил какие-либо java-файлы, мне нужно это делать Run as -> Mvn installили Mvn...

134
Spring Java Config: как создать @Bean в прототипе с аргументами времени выполнения?

Используя Spring Java Config, мне нужно получить / создать экземпляр bean-компонента с прототипом с аргументами конструктора, которые доступны только во время выполнения. Рассмотрим следующий пример кода (упрощенный для краткости): @Autowired private ApplicationContext appCtx; public void...